Heartland Documents

Richard Stallman - Wed, 02/22/2012 - 14:00

Climate scientist Peter Gleick says he obtained the Heartland documents by pretending to be someone else.

This affirms that the documents are genuine, except perhaps for the one which Gleick says he received anonymously and sought to validate. However, he says that the other documents agree with that one in substance.

Global Heating Affected Russia

Richard Stallman - Wed, 02/22/2012 - 14:00

The Russian heatwave of 2010, which destroyed a large amount of the harvest, became 3 times as likely due to global heating.

In other words, it could have happened without global heating, but probably would not have happened.

Truth About ACTA

Richard Stallman - Tue, 02/21/2012 - 14:00

ACTA is part of a multi-decade, worldwide copyright campaign by governments working for corporations to impose injustice.

One step in resisting their demands is rejecting their propaganda terms. Why say "copyright protection" when it is shorter and easier to say "copyright"? Copyright lawyers use the word "protection" because it spins the copyright issue their way. Since they are the "experts", their way of speaking is prestigious, so others imitate it in order to sound prestigious.
